  • What steps are involved in the hoarding cleanup process?

    The hoarding cleanup process typically follows a structured approach to ensure efficiency and emotional sensitivity. First, a professional team conducts an assessment to determine the severity of the hoarding situation. Next, they develop a cleanup plan that includes sorting items into categories such as keep, donate, recycle, and discard. After decluttering, the team deep cleans and sanitizes the area, removing biohazards, mold, and pests if necessary. The final step often involves organizing the remaining items to create a functional living space. Many services also offer follow-up support to help individuals maintain a clean and safe environment.

  • How long does hoarding cleanup take?

    The duration of a hoarding cleanup depends on several factors, including the severity of the hoarding situation, the size of the property, and the availability of resources. A minor cleanup may take a few days, while severe cases involving extensive clutter and hazardous materials can take several weeks. Professional cleanup teams work efficiently to clear out debris, deep clean, and organize the space while ensuring the individual is comfortable with the pace of progress. Some companies also offer multi-phase cleanups to help individuals gradually adjust to the process.
